In July 1996, Blair Adams, a 31-year-old Canadian man, was found dead under highly unusual and unexplained circumstances in Knoxville, Tennessee. His murder remains one of the strangest unsolved cases to this day, with chilling details that suggest he was either running from something or someone before his brutal demise.

The Sudden Panic

Blair was an ordinary man with no known enemies. He worked in construction, was well-liked by colleagues, and had no history of mental illness. But in early July, his behavior took a drastic and unsettling turn.

He suddenly withdrew all the money from his savings, emptied his safety deposit box, and took a large amount of cash, gold, and jewelry. His friends and family noticed his growing paranoia he repeatedly told them someone was trying to kill him but refused to say who or why. His mother later recalled that he seemed absolutely terrified, as if he was running from something invisible and imminent.

The Strange Journey

His escape attempts were just as baffling as his fear. He first tried to cross the U.S. border into Seattle on July 8, but border officials denied him entry because he was carrying an excessive amount of cash, which raised suspicion. Instead of taking a logical route to leave Canada, Blair booked a flight from Vancouver to Seattle, then took another flight to Washington D.C., and finally ended up in Knoxville, a completely illogical, random route with no clear purpose.

There was no known reason for him to be in Knoxville. He had no family, friends, or business there, making his presence even more bizarre.

The Motel Incident

Upon arriving in Knoxville, Blair checked into a motel, but his behavior was anything but normal. After paying for the room, he immediately left without even going inside. Surveillance cameras captured him acting erratically in the hotel lobby, running in and out of the building multiple times as if he was being chased.

He was visibly distressed, looking over his shoulder as if someone or something was after him. However, no one was seen pursuing him on the footage.

The Bizarre Death

Hours later, Blair Adams was found dead in a parking lot near a construction site. His body was discovered in a truly disturbing state:

His pants had been removed.

His shoes were off.

His shirt was ripped open.

Scattered around his body was $4,000 in cash, gold, and jewelry, ruling out robbery as a motive.

The autopsy revealed that Blair had been beaten to death likely with someone’s bare hands. There was no murder weapon, and no clear signs of a struggle that could explain the odd condition of his body.

Theories & Unanswered Questions

Blair’s case remains one of the most confounding unsolved mysteries. To this day, no one knows what he was running from or who ultimately killed him. Theories range from mental illness to something far more sinister:

  • A mental breakdown? – Some believe Blair suffered from an undiagnosed psychotic episode that led to extreme paranoia, causing him to flee in confusion.
  • Was he actually being followed? – His genuine terror and erratic travel choices suggest that he truly believed he was in danger. Could he have been fleeing from a real threat?
  • Did he get caught up in something shady? – Some speculate that Blair may have unknowingly angered the wrong people—possibly a criminal organization or someone involved in illicit activities.

No Leads, No Closure....

What makes Blair’s case even more frustrating is the complete lack of evidence. There were no fingerprints, no murder weapon, and no witnesses. His killer left behind all of his valuables, making the motive even more perplexing. The only certainty? Blair Adams was running from something or someone.
